Transaction 31ad14b014a673049386b4610196dbcce3026faa28af6ae80862c60dfc3f92c4

1 Input
2 Outputs
  • 31ad14b014a673049386b4610196dbcce3026faa28af6ae80862c60dfc3f92c4:0
  • value  361811
    address  3LhfvWhKQbk2dYknZmPXzw8TQCMGAJWJF1
  • 31ad14b014a673049386b4610196dbcce3026faa28af6ae80862c60dfc3f92c4:1
  • value  3006596
    address  39CR9FeifrTRygo42Nma6bikQUpBxRDwVJ